      Movie Info

      Synopsis A woman tries to prove her son's innocence after he becomes the prime suspect in the murder of a wealthy wife.
      Director
      Douglas Jackson
      Producer
      Tom Berry, Pierre David, Louis A. Massicotte
      Screenwriter
      Christine Conradt, Ken Sanders
      Production Co
      Columbia
      Rating
      TV-PG (V|S|L)
      Genre
      Mystery & Thriller
      Original Language
      English
      Release Date (DVD)
      Nov 1, 2005
      Runtime
      1h 36m
